Website Security Best Practices to Protect Business Data and Customers
In today's digital age, where online presence is paramount, ensuring the security of your website is crucial. As businesses increasingly rely on web applications for operations and customer interactions, website security best practices have become a focal point for safeguarding sensitive data and maintaining customer trust. This blog will delve into essential measures you can implement to enhance web application security, ensure secure website development, and protect against cyber threats.
Understanding the Importance of Website Security
Website security is not just a technical requirement; it’s a critical aspect of business strategy. With rising cyber threats, every organization, especially those operating in India, must prioritize the protection of their digital assets. A single data breach can lead to significant financial losses, harm your brand's reputation, and erode customer trust. Therefore, implementing effective website protection strategies is vital for every business owner.
Website Security Best Practices
1. Use HTTPS
One of the fundamental website security best practices is to ensure that your website uses HTTPS instead of HTTP. HTTPS encrypts the data exchanged between the user's browser and your server, making it difficult for cybercriminals to intercept sensitive information. This is especially important for e-commerce websites where customers share personal and payment information.
2. Regular Software Updates
Keeping your website's software, plugins, and themes updated is crucial for maintaining web application security. Developers regularly release updates to patch security vulnerabilities. Failing to update can leave your website open to exploitations by hackers. Establish a routine for checking and applying updates to ensure your website remains secure.
3. Strong Password Policies
Implementing strong password policies is essential in preventing unauthorized access. Encourage users to create complex passwords that include a mix of letters, numbers, and special characters. Additionally, consider implementing two-factor authentication (2FA) for an extra layer of security. This requires users to verify their identity through a secondary method, providing enhanced protection against cyber threats.
4. Use a Web Application Firewall (WAF)
A Web Application Firewall acts as a barrier between your website and potential threats. It monitors and filters incoming traffic, blocking malicious requests before they reach your server. Investing in a reputable WAF can significantly reduce the risk of attacks such as SQL injection, cross-site scripting (XSS), and distributed denial-of-service (DDoS).
5. Regular Backups
Regularly backing up your website is an often-overlooked aspect of website protection. In the event of a cyber attack or data loss, having recent backups can save you from significant operational disruptions. Store your backups in a secure location and test them periodically to ensure their integrity and reliability.
6. Secure Your Hosting Environment
The security of your website is closely tied to the reliability of your hosting provider. Choose a hosting service that prioritizes security, offers features like firewalls, malware scanning, and DDoS protection. Additionally, ensure that your hosting environment is configured correctly to minimize vulnerabilities.
7. Implement Content Security Policy (CSP)
A Content Security Policy is a security feature that helps prevent various types of attacks, such as cross-site scripting (XSS) and data injection. By defining which sources of content are trustworthy, you can limit the risk of malicious scripts running on your website. Implementing a CSP is a proactive step towards enhancing web application security.
8. Monitor and Audit Regularly
Continuous monitoring and regular audits of your website can help you identify vulnerabilities before they can be exploited. Use security tools to scan for malware, check for outdated software, and monitor user activity for any suspicious behavior. Regular audits can also help ensure compliance with data protection regulations.
Common Cyber Security Threats to Websites
Understanding the types of cyber threats your website may face is essential for implementing effective security measures. Here are some common cyber security threats to be aware of:
1. Malware
Malware refers to malicious software designed to disrupt, damage, or gain unauthorized access to computer systems. It can infect your website and compromise data security, leading to severe consequences.
2. Phishing Attacks
Phishing attacks often involve tricking users into providing sensitive information like usernames and passwords by masquerading as a trustworthy entity. Educating your customers about these threats can help them recognize and avoid falling victim.
3. DDoS Attacks
Distributed Denial-of-Service (DDoS) attacks aim to overwhelm your website with an influx of traffic, rendering it unavailable to legitimate users. Implementing protective measures like WAF can help mitigate the impact of DDoS attacks.
4. Data Breaches
Data breaches occur when unauthorized individuals gain access to sensitive data. This can lead to identity theft, legal repercussions, and loss of customer trust. Adhering to security best practices is crucial to preventing data breaches.
Conclusion
In an increasingly digital landscape, prioritizing website security is no longer optional; it’s a necessity. By following the website security best practices outlined in this blog, you can significantly enhance your website's protection against cyber threats. Remember that security is an ongoing process. Stay informed about the latest security trends and continue to adapt your strategies accordingly.
FAQs about Website Security Best Practices
Q1: What are website security best practices for small businesses?
A1: Small businesses should focus on implementing HTTPS, regular software updates, strong password policies, and regular backups to protect their websites effectively.
Q2: How often should I update my website's software?
A2: It is advisable to check for updates at least once a month and apply critical updates immediately to ensure your website remains secure.
Q3: Can using a free hosting service affect my website's security?
A3: Yes, free hosting services often lack robust security features, making your website more vulnerable to attacks. Investing in a reputable hosting provider is crucial for maintaining security.
Q4: What is the role of a Web Application Firewall?
A4: A Web Application Firewall (WAF) protects your website by filtering and monitoring HTTP traffic between the web application and the Internet, preventing various types of attacks.
Q5: How can I educate my customers about cyber security threats?
A5: You can create informative content, such as blog posts or newsletters, and share tips on recognizing phishing attempts and maintaining their online safety.
Call to Action
Don’t wait until it’s too late! Start implementing these website security best practices today to protect your business data and customers. If you need assistance with secure website development or enhancing your cyber security for websites, contact us for expert advice tailored to your business needs!
Leave a Comment